1. OBJECTIVE
The objective of this Simatic WinCC V7.5 software is a web-based user interface for
managing online temperature, RH and alarm, data logging and email alert system.
Simatic WinCC V7.5 is a supervisory control and data acquisition (SCADA) and human-
machine interface (HMI) system from Siemens. SCADA systems are used to monitor and
control physical processes involved in industry and infrastructure on a large scale and
over long distances. Simatic WinCC can be used in combination with Siemens
controllers.

4. INTRODUCTION
The Simatic WinCC V7.5 software is a set of processes and procedures required for
monitoring and recording of online temperature, RH of user set-limits. Also, with email
alert and alarm system in case of any deviations in the temperature and RH at Bioneeds
and maintenance of these records are as per OECD GLP regulations.
5. CURRENT SYSTEM
Manual procedure (i.e., paper-based records) with the aid of digital thermohydrometer
adopted at Bioneeds for monitoring and recording of temperature and RH for the required
components in GLP system.
6. PROCESS OVERVIEW
With the increasing demanding regulatory requirement for compliance vis-à-vis the rapid
pace of organization growth, managing and recording temperature and RH processes
becomes cumbersome. Lots of documents are generated across sites and monitoring of
these related records becomes both resource and time consuming. So, requirement arises
for centralized automated Building Management System (BMS) software which shall
cater all these requirements with better control in place. The BMS i.e., Simatic WinCC
V7.5 provide an online compliant with features of online recording and monitoring of
temperature and RH in addition to data logging, alarm and email alert system for any
deviations in the recorded temperature.

8.10 Audit Trail Requirement
Requirement Requirement
Category
Reference
UR-8.10.1 Software shall track for all modifications,
audit trail and deletions performed with
URS: BMS Page: 8 of 15
Requirement Requirement
Category
Reference
reason and date and time stamped along with
user details.
UR-8.10.2 The software shall automatically record
Audit Trail unauthorized login attempts.
Audit trail function must be always ON (by
UR-8.10.3
default), and impossible to disable the audit
trail function.
Audit trail documentation shall be retained
UR-8.10.4
for a period, and it shall be available for
review if required.
UR-8.10.5 Archive records shall be retrievable.
UR-8.10.6 Predefined and configurable filters shall be
available to view the audit trail.
The system audit trail must track the creation,
modification, deletion of records and
Updating records including the following
a. Identity of the person making the
change
b. Action that creates, modify/ change
UR-8.10.7
and/or delete a record
c. Time and date that the change was
affected
d. Reason for modification/change to a
record Changes made may not
obscure old information.
Audit Trail
The audit trail must be searchable,
transferable electronically and printable in
human readable format.
System must have provision for secure,
computer- generated, time-stamped audit
trail that records the date and time of operator
UR-8.10.8 entries and actions that create, modify, or
delete electronic records with reason
Prompt.
System shall track for all creations,
modifications and deletions performed in the
system (All activity shall be logged between
login and log out) with time and date stamp
along with user details.

The audit trail must always be "on", entries
UR-8.10.9
must be recorded automatically when a
transaction occurs.
The audit trail generation must be outside the
UR-8.10.10
control of and access of all users as well as
system administrators.
UR-8.10.11 The audit trail must be protected
from any modification/ deletion
